GC浅谈

GC浅谈 首先思考垃圾收集(Garbage Collection,GC)需要完成的三件事情 1)哪些内存需要回收? 2)什么时候回收? 3)如何回收? 哪些内存需要回收? 1.对象已死 所谓对象已死,其实就是垃圾收集器在对堆进行回收之前需要判断这些对象中哪些还“存活着”,哪些已经“死去”。 2.判断算法 1)引用计数法(Reference Counting):许多教科书上判断对象是否存活都是这个算
相关文章
相关标签/搜索